Still want to be a style designer come hell or rain?

Here are three mantras you ought to memorize:

1) Your portfolio can be your design identity

Just like how celebrity models value their looks and work with maintaining their charm, you need to do the exact same for the portfolio. Future employers and the general public are likely to judge you based on your own skill to style fabulous pieces. And your portfolio is going to show them exactly that which you are capable of.

Irrespective of how hard you work, procrastination may be very difficult to beat sometimes. So the easiest way to obtain probably the most versatile fashion design portfolio would be to enroll for a style course. Being in school will force you to leave your comfort zones. With the right training and dedication, email address details are often impressive.

2) Understand just why people dress the direction they do

The Japanese have their kimonos, the Indians have their saris, and the Chinese have their cheongsams. Even though global fashion is currently mainly influenced by top fashion cities like Paris, New York, and London, people around the world still dress differently. A genuine fashion designer has got the EQ to understand what customers want and need.

Are people feeling warm in tropical climates? Do others need to full cover up for religious reasons? What kind of jobs do they have? Are your designs simplistic yet stylish enough to be worn each and every day?

As it pertains to fashion psychology, the variables are endless. Yes, you might argue it is more fun to style for haute couture. But in reality, fashion is more of a business than an art. Even the rich from the greatest echelons continue to be humans. One of the greatest methods to grow as a style designer is to generate clothes for everyday people.

The exciting bit about fashion is so it changes every day. So no two days will ever be the same.

3) Find a good fashion school

It may make most of the difference in your life. Good schools have the facilities you need. And additionally they hire lecturers that are well-connected within the industry. Have plans to be an international fashion designer? Consider enrolling into an international school. This lets you meet many sorts of folks from across the world. And it will also help you learn a little more about understanding people like mentioned earlier.

During school, you will work on assignments necessary to construct the most effective portfolio before you graduate. You is likely to make your own fashion collections, sketch your best designs, and pay homage by studying about the different designs and designers that made fashion history. A fashion design student’s life is nothing lacking colorful and exciting.

If you feel that your country may be too conservative for full creative expression, an alternative is to study fashion abroad. Countries like Australia and Singapore are well suited for an English-speaking environment and career opportunities after graduation.

Feeling adventurous? Studying in developing nations can assist you to conserve money on craft materials. And of course, countries with strong manufacturing industries allow you to build a contact list of reliable suppliers. This will come in handy when you wish to start your own label. Living costs in a developing nation is also less costly, so you spend less on your overall education. Countries like China, Thailand, and Sri Lanka can offer you this experience.
